The Tubbs Flex VRT Snowshoes were designed to deliver premium performance for backcountry exploration. The new DynamicFit binding with the Boa Closure System produces evenly distributed tension around your boot for ultimate precision. The FLEX Tail design eases stress on your joints, allowing you to reach even the most intense summits.
Features of Tubbs Flex VRT Snowshoes:
Torsion Deck: adapts to variable snow conditions underfoot. The decks allow torsional articulation throughout the body of the snowshoe, enhancing traction, biomechanics and comfort on uneven terrain.
Rotation Toe Cord-Rotatin Limiter: design enables the tail of the snowshoe to drop and snow to shed off the tail, reducing cardio-respiratory strain by 7%. The underfoot pivot point also allows the toe traction teeth to bite deeply into the snow when weighted. A rotation limiter prevents over-rotation and shin bang
Dynamicfit Binding: integrates the Boa Closure System with the comfort of EVA foam to produce even pressure distribution around your boot, creating precise fit and optimized control. Releasing the binding is as simple as pulling up on the Boa dial
Flex Tail: absorbs shock from heel strike, reducing the amount of stress on your joints and allowing you to snowshoe farther, longer and with less stress on your body
Viper 2.0 Crampon: carbon steel toe crampon with jagged tooth construction maximizes weighted traction and responsiveness
Traction Rails: ensure superior side-hill grip in hard or icy conditions. Progressive molded Snow Brakes, on the deck as well as the Soft Strike zone, improve weighted traction
